Seamlessly Adapt to Business Growth
One of the most significant limitations of legacy phone systems is their lack of scalability. Adding a new employee or opening a new office could mean weeks of waiting for new lines to be installed and significant capital expenditure. With VoIP phone services, scaling your communications is as simple as a few clicks in a software portal. You can add or remove users, assign extensions, and deploy new phone lines almost instantly. This agility allows your Princeton-based business to respond quickly to market demands, onboard staff efficiently, and expand operations without the friction of outdated technology.

The Foundation of Reliable VoIP: Your Network Infrastructure
The clarity and reliability of your calls are directly tied to the health of your network. Poor call quality, dropped calls, and jitter are often symptoms of an inadequate network infrastructure, not a flaw in VoIP technology itself. To ensure crystal-clear conversations, your network must be optimized to prioritize voice traffic. This is where professional planning and implementation become critical.
An expert network infrastructure consulting team can assess your current environment, identify potential bottlenecks, and ensure your system is configured for optimal performance. Key Steps for a Flawless VoIP Implementation
- 1. Comprehensive Network Assessment: Before migration, a thorough analysis of your existing network—including bandwidth, routers, and switches—is crucial to confirm it can handle the demands of high-quality voice traffic.
- 2. Strategic Provider Selection: Choose a provider that acts as a long-term partner, offering end-to-end support from design and installation to ongoing management. Look for expertise in both telecommunications and network infrastructure.
- 3. Meticulous Number Porting: Plan the process of transferring your existing phone numbers carefully to ensure zero downtime and a seamless transition for your customers and staff.
- 4. Thorough User Training: To maximize your ROI, ensure your team receives proper training on all the new features and functionalities of the VoIP system. This accelerates adoption and unlocks immediate productivity gains.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. What exactly is VoIP and how does it work?
VoIP stands for Voice over Internet Protocol. It’s a technology that allows you to make and receive phone calls over the internet instead of traditional analog phone lines. It converts your voice into a digital signal that travels over your network, offering more flexibility and features than a standard phone system.
2. Will switching to VoIP disrupt my business operations?
With proper planning and a professional installation partner, there should be minimal to no disruption. A carefully managed migration, including a strategic plan for porting your existing numbers, ensures a seamless transition so your business can continue operating without interruption.
3. Is VoIP secure for enterprise use?
Yes. Reputable enterprise-grade VoIP providers use robust security measures, including call encryption and secure data centers, to protect your communications. Just like any network-based technology, security also depends on proper network configuration and best practices, which an expert consultant can help implement.
4. Can I keep my existing business phone numbers?
Absolutely. The process is called ‘number porting,’ and it allows you to transfer your existing phone numbers from your old provider to your new VoIP service. This means you can upgrade your technology without losing the phone numbers your clients already know.
5. How much can our business realistically save by switching to VoIP?
Savings vary based on your current provider and usage, but most businesses see significant cost reductions. Savings come from lower monthly line rental fees, elimination of most long-distance charges, and simplified infrastructure.
